      Where does diorite come from?

      The word diorite breaks down into 2 roots of Greek origin: diorite, from Greek diorizein (“to distinguish, separate (named for its distinguishable crystals)”); and -ite, from Greek ites (“mineral/rock (noun suffix)”). Explore each root to see other English words built from the same source.
